作者: 羅寶鴻 | 適讀年齡: 成人 | 繁體中文 | 288 頁 | 平裝 | 17 x 23 x 1.44 cm | 出版日期:2017年6月28日


No.1兼具幼兒發展理論、實際案例、具體教養步驟的
全方位蒙特梭利教養書
「爸媽不發飆,孩子輕鬆教」的優雅教養祕訣!
32則案例28個QA分享 × 73個蒙特梭利專家觀點 × 3階段幼兒教養提醒

  孩子愛亂碰東西、一意孤行、自我中心、
  在餐廳亂叫、推人搶玩具、要玩具不買就哭鬧……
  好言相勸被當耳邊風,罵他又不聽,打了又心疼,
  最怕的就是他當眾哭鬧……唉~教孩子怎麼就這麼難啊!

  別擔心!20年幼教經驗的蒙特梭利專家Henry羅寶鴻老師教你——

  優雅教養6大祕訣

  【祕訣1】制定明確規範並堅持態度——確立原則、堅持原則
  【祕訣2】與孩子討論並約定——事前約定
  【祕訣3】孩子違反規範時,成人可先採取的措施——提醒四步驟
  【祕訣4】幫助孩子建立規範的祕訣——兩個選擇
  【祕訣5】淡定面對孩子的情緒反應——同理但不處理、不要坐以待斃
  【祕訣6】正確對待孩子錯誤的方式——秋後算帳

  讀懂孩子身心發展特色,教養事半功倍——

  【8~10個月】愛亂丟東西、跟大人玩你丟我撿
  Q. 孩子現在10個月,老愛故意丟手上的東西怎麼辦?
  A: 孩子不是頑皮!此時他的手部髓鞘化到達手掌及手指,正處於「有意識釋放手中物品」的發展期,這是孩子在成長過程中,為完美自身動作的必然階段性發展過程,動作精鍊就不會亂丟東西。

  【1~1.5歲】愛玩日常生活中的易碎品
  Q. 孩子1歲2個月,老愛玩爸媽的玻璃杯,怎麼勸都勸不聽……
  A: 這時期的孩子處於探索環境期,想探索日常生活環境的內在衝動比後天控制力強,與其不讓孩子碰這些「易碎品」,不如教他如何小心使用,再由大人在一旁觀察監護。孩子在探索的過程中可以滿足內在需求並發展專注力。

  【1.5~3歲】喜歡說「不要!」、講都講不聽
  Q. 孩子2歲半,大人叫他不要做的事情講都講不聽,該怎麼辦?
  A: 1.5~3歲的孩子正處於「自我認同危機期」,當他想做一件事被成人阻止,就會有強烈的反抗行為,也開始會跟成人說「不要」,來切割自己與成人。可活用本書的「提醒四步驟」、「兩個選擇」、「同理不處理」,讓孩子體驗做了錯誤選擇後的結果。

  【1.5~3歲】不要大人幫忙卻又愛生氣
  Q.孩子2歲半,玩積木蓋房子做不好,自己生氣又不讓大人幫忙……
  A:在孩子沒有主動要求下,成人不干涉孩子的活動、或協助孩子,否則可能讓他失去了自我修正、自我學習、以及自我完美的機會。培養孩子獨立自主的能力,注意不要給予他不必要的協助。

  【1.5~3歲】孩子愛推別人、搶別人玩具
  Q.孩子2歲8個月,只要覺得其他小朋友會來搶他正在玩的東西,就會動手推人,怎麼辦?
  A:這是孩子在2~3歲發展中常出現的行為(尤其是男生),不是他「故意不聽話」或「講都講不聽」。若有需要,家長可以用「溫和、穩定」的態度介入。先安撫受委屈的孩子,就能讓孩子知道冒犯了別人,之後重申規範,確立原則。

  【4~6歲】做錯事會怪罪別人
  Q. 4歲孩子做錯事後一直抱
:「都是媽媽害的!」「我討厭媽媽!」該怎麼辦呢?
  A:在「自我認同危機期」時,成人若沒有做到「給予孩子選擇的機會」,讓他「經驗選擇後的結果」,孩子就不會學到如何做出正確選擇、並為自己的行為負責任。孩子出現這些不尊重的話語時,當下要清楚跟他說明;之後在適當時機跟孩子討論,並約定以後不講這些不尊重父母的話。

  【4~6歲】不給他買玩具就耍賴、大哭
  Q. 4歲孩子到百貨公司吵著買玩具、不給他買就當眾尖叫大哭……
  A: 孩子哭鬧時,不要用責備、對立的方式繼續挑釁他的情緒。活用「堅持原則」、「同理但不處理」、「不要坐以待斃」、以及「轉移孩子注意力」的方法,就能解決孩子耍賴的問題。
